Dallas Anesthesiologist Convicted for Fatal Tampering with IV Fluid Bags

In a disturbing case that shocked the medical community, a Dallas anesthesiologist, Raynaldo Rivera Ortiz Jr., was found guilty on Friday of tampering with intravenous fluid bags at a surgical center where he worked. This reckless act led to the death of a coworker and caused cardiac emergencies for several patients, according to federal prosecutors. Ortiz, 60, now faces a potential sentence of up to 190 years in prison for his egregious actions.

Conviction and Charges

Ortiz was convicted by a jury on four counts of tampering with consumer products resulting in serious bodily injury, one count of tampering with a consumer product, and five counts of intentional adulteration of a drug. The gravity of his offenses is reflected in the severe charges brought against him. Despite the severity of the situation, a sentencing date for Ortiz has not yet been determined.

Deceptive Practices and Consequences

Evidence presented during the trial revealed Ortiz’s deceptive practices, which endangered the lives of patients under his care. It was revealed that numerous patients at Surgicare North Dallas experienced cardiac emergencies during routine medical procedures between May 2022 and August 2022. Tragically, an anesthesiologist who had treated herself for dehydration using an IV bag earlier in the day died as a result of Ortiz’s tampering. Prosecutors outlined how Ortiz surreptitiously placed tainted IV bags into a warming bin at the facility, intending for them to be used during surgeries performed by his colleagues.

Moreover, it was disclosed that Ortiz was under scrutiny for an alleged medical error made during one of his surgeries at the time of the emergency.
